So, the way the angel hunting business work is a division of 3 main phases:

1) La Cacería (the hunting)

2) La Tablajería (the butchering)

3) El Expendio (the actual selling)

Before I have it all abstracted in 3 moves. But after some playtesting it comes to my attention that, even though we create the “Changarro” (a.k.a. the business), with some flavourful characteristics, we then forgot about it and went into other directions. Also some players felt like “lost”, not sure what it is that they characters should be doing.

This could be of course, my poor MCing in action. But I’ve also considered to give more depth to the 3 aforementioned phases of the angel hunting trade.

So, what about making each, an actual phase of the game, instead of just a move. Something kind of like what Blades in the Dark does. (Nightwitches also comes to mind)

New move for the Perro playbook. Inspired by Jason Cordova’s custom labyrinth move:

Dog of Xolotl

When you navigate your pack through the Underworld, roll with NAHUALITY. On a 10+, hold 1. On a 7-9, hold 1, but you also encounter a guardian. On a fail, you encounter a guardian.

You can spend 3 holds at any time to find whatever you are looking for.

Hey everyone, here is a couple more for the Tlacuache, I would like to know if they are different enough and if one is obviously more “powerful” than the other one or not:

ILLUSION

When you want to fool someone senses to make them do what you want, roll with NAHUALITY. On a hit, they fall for it. On a 7-9, pick one:

• The effect is short.

• The effect is partial.

• Mark stress.

ESPEJISMO

When you transform, roll with NAHUALITY. On a 10+, you get 4 holds. On a 7-9 you get 2. You can spend them at any time to alter other people’s perception, making them see you:

• Like someone in specific (2 holds).

• Like any person in general: an old man, a young lady, etc (1 hold)

• The mirage will stay in their memories (1 holds).

• The mirage won’t affect the persons you picked (1 hold).

• The mirage will extend to electronic devices: video, photos, etc. (1 hold).

On a fail, you still get 1 hold. But if you use it the mirage will have a flaw or deficiency. The Marakame will tell you what.

New Tlacuache move:

PLAY POSSUM

When you play dead to avoid a conflict, mark all your harm boxes. Your body will look dead—you won’t even have a pulse. They can do any harm to your body, tear it apart, burn it, etc. It doesn’t matter, whenever you choose to, you’ll wake up completely regenerated. Clear all your harm boxes.
